Save fails on one or more products

Symptoms: you click Save all changes, the progress bar moves, but some products show a failure indicator and stay in the "Unsaved" state.

Most common causes:

  • A product was modified in Shopify admin between your edit and your save. Refresh the Organizer view to pull current state, redo your changes, save again.
  • A product is locked by another app or process. Wait a minute and retry. If it persists, identify the other app (often a bulk-edit app or a Flow workflow).
  • Shopify rate limit hit. Easy Image Organizer paces saves to avoid this, but very large batches can occasionally trip it. Wait two minutes and retry.

Failed products stay in the modified set so you can retry without redoing the edit.

"Auto optimize all" overwrote my hand-written alt text

Cause: that's what the button does. It runs auto-optimisation on every image in the current view.

Prevention next time: filter to "Alt text status = Missing" before clicking Auto optimise all, so only missing alt text gets filled. Or use the per-row wand icon for selective optimisation.

Recovery: Easy Image Organizer doesn't keep a history of old alt text. If you have it backed up (e.g. from a Shopify export), restore from there. Going forward, work in smaller filtered sweeps.

Duplicate scanner is stuck

Symptoms: scan has been running for a long time with no progress.

Causes (in order):

  • Browser tab was throttled. Some browsers throttle background tabs. Bring the tab to the front and keep it open.
  • Network blip. Refresh the page. The scan offers a Resume button if it was interrupted.
  • 30-minute scan-lock not released. Easy Image Organizer auto-releases stuck scan locks after 30 minutes. If you triggered a scan that hung, wait 30 minutes from the start time before triggering a new one.

If a scan has been running for over an hour with no progress, contact support.

Duplicate scanner finishes but finds nothing

Symptoms: scan completes, no duplicate groups shown.

Cause: you probably don't have visual duplicates! This is the most common reason. Some clean catalogues are genuinely dedup-free.

Less common causes:

  • All duplicates were already cleaned in a previous scan. The scanner only finds current state.
  • Your duplicates are crops or recolours, not visual duplicates. Perceptual hashing catches identical-looking images at different sizes/compression. It doesn't catch images that are visibly different (cropped, recoloured, edited).

"Free plan limit reached" but I'm under 100

Symptoms: upgrade modal appears even though you don't think you've made 100 edits.

Cause: the counter ticks at save time, not at modify time. If you've done lots of reorder/delete/upload cycles, even small ones, each save tick counts.

Check: open the Plans page in Easy Image Organizer. It shows the exact counter for the current billing cycle.

If the counter genuinely looks wrong, contact support with your shop URL.

Image SEO tool doesn't show "Not used" images

Symptoms: switching to the "Not used" view returns nothing.

Cause: every image in your store is attached to a product or collection. Lucky you. The "Not used" view finds files in Shopify Files that aren't referenced elsewhere - if you've never uploaded files directly to Shopify Files (only via product creation), there usually aren't any.

Images won't drag

Symptoms: you hover the image strip but the drag handle doesn't appear, or dragging doesn't move the image.

Causes:

  • Browser extensions can interfere. Try Incognito/Private window.
  • Touch device without active touch. On laptops with both trackpad and touchscreen, sometimes the touch handler captures the event. Click the image first, then drag.
  • Very slow connection. Drag-and-drop requires the image thumbnail to be loaded. Wait for the strip to render fully.

Upload fails silently

Symptoms: you drop an image on the "+" tile and nothing happens.

Causes:

  • File too large. Shopify enforces file size limits. Try a smaller version.
  • Unsupported format. Shopify supports JPEG, PNG, GIF, and WebP for product images. HEIC, SVG (in most product contexts), and other formats fail silently.
  • Network blip. Refresh and retry.
